TierConnect, Inc. Names Leland Grubb as Board Chairman

Wixom, Mich., December 13, 2005—Wixom, Mich.-based software provider, TierConnect, Inc. announced today the appointment of automotive industry veteran Leland Grubb as chairman of its board of directors. The announcement was made by TierConnect president and CEO, Michael Betts. Founded in 2002, TierConnect provides manufacturing and other continuous improvement material management environments with customized software applications to keep pace with rapid changes in business processes.

TierConnect’s premier application, ConnectNCM™ is a nonconforming material management system designed to replace traditional hand-written, nonconforming material identification tag systems in manufacturing facilities. ConnectNCM is powered by CoreConnect™, a unique web technology engineered to drive application functionality for continuous improvement manufacturing environments.

Grubb is the chief financial officer for Engineered Plastic Products (EPP) of Ypsilanti, Mich. EPP holds major contracts with DaimlerChrysler Corporation, as well as General Motors Corporation, specializing in the design and manufacturing of plastic injection-molded interior trim components.

Previously, Grubb was a principal at ChangeScape, Inc., a healthcare consultancy delivering process and information technology solutions to the healthcare industry. Grubb has held financial leadership roles with SupplySolution, Inc., Thomas Group, Detroit Diesel Corporation and General Motors Corporation.

Grubb earned a bachelor of arts from Thiel College in 1966 and an MBA degree from Kent State University in 1968. In 1984, he completed Harvard University’s Post Management Development Program.
